How to spot a Ponzi coin
Ponzi coins like SafeMoon, Baby Doge Coin, and FEG token require users to pay a redistribution or reflection fee for selling and sometimes transferring coins. These coins typically live on the Binance Smart Chain, although many are based on Ethereum. Usually a portion of the fee is burnt or withdrawn from circulation. By doing this, the projects pretend to be revolutionary deflationary currencies when in reality they are not doing anything new at all.
The rest of the fees that are not burned are redistributed to the token holders, in proportion to their share of the total supply. Project leaders will then describe this return as a source of passive income when the majority of the money actually goes to the creators who hold the biggest share of the pie. As these rich few sit down and sell their winnings, the token loses value as the passionate community refuses to sell (and pay the huge tax) and goes broke. Another thing to watch out for is a portion of the redistribution donated to charity. These projects often do this to disguise their intention.

What is blockchain?
A blockchain is a database or a public computer based on the Internet. All over the world, people known as miners are contributing their computing resources to the blockchain network for profit. Users pay to access this global computer because of the benefits offered by its decentralized nature.
However, not all blockchains are created the same, as many of them are only controlled by a few powerful players. Nodes are complete copies of the entire blockchain. Each node must contain an identical copy of the blockchain, and these nodes must always communicate and reach consensus on recent events. These recent events can be transactions or smart contracts, but regardless, they are grouped into time intervals (blocks) and chained together.
The blocking time for Bitcoins is around 10 minutes, while Ethereums is closer to 15 seconds. At the end of each block, the current state of the database (portfolio balances updated after a batch of transactions) is finalized by consensus. If a few nodes try to slip in a few more BTCs, their proposed version of the block will be rejected by the group as a whole. This solution is possible because the individual actors across the network only benefit from honesty. Dishonesty can only be achieved by corrupting 51% of the total network power (51% attack). For large blockchains, a 51% attack is not economical; however, small blockchains like Ethereum Classic are often attacked with success.
After confidence in mainstream finance collapsed after the 2008 financial crisis, an anonymous person using the name Satoshi Nakamoto realized the need for a trustless store of value. The magic of blockchain is that when a network of individual actors as a whole is properly incentivized, the need for trust is theoretically suppressed. Satoshi realized that a blockchain-based trustless ledger (like the ledgers that all centralized banks use to track account balances) would solve the problem. It’s Bitcoin.
A few years later, Russian programmer Vitalik Buterin took the powers of decentralization to the next level. Instead of a payment ledger, what if a blockchain was a general-purpose virtual machine that worked as a place for developers to build all kinds of apps that could benefit from running decentralization? It’s Ethereum. The developers quickly understood the implications of this ecosystem and began to rebuild the entire financial ecosystem on the blockchain. The result is called Decentralized Finance, or DeFi, and although it is only 5 years old, it is already empowering the 40% of the world’s unbanked population and threatens to end traditional finance as we know it. .

Decentralized exchanges
A DEX like Uniswap allows users to swap between currencies based on the Ethereum blockchain (other DEXs exist on other chains and allow users to trade the assets of those chains because blockchains are not yet interoperable) . Liquidity for any given swap is also provided by users, called liquidity providers (LPs), who collect the swap fee to provide liquidity. Because the process is anonymous and decentralized, it allows users to earn stablecoins like USDC without using a centralized exchange.
